ネム(XEM)の今後に期待される新機能
ネム(XEM)は、その独特なアーキテクチャと高いセキュリティ性から、ブロックチェーン技術の分野において重要な位置を占めてきました。当初、分散型台帳技術としての基本的な機能を提供することに重点が置かれていましたが、技術の進歩と市場のニーズの変化に伴い、ネムは進化を続けています。本稿では、ネム(XEM)の今後の発展において期待される新機能について、技術的な側面と実用的な応用例を交えながら詳細に解説します。
1. モザイク(Mosaic)機能の拡張
ネムの基盤技術であるモザイクは、トークン発行やアセット管理を容易にする重要な機能です。現在、モザイクは基本的なトークン発行機能を提供していますが、今後の拡張により、より複雑な金融商品の表現や、スマートコントラクトとの連携が可能になると期待されます。具体的には、以下の機能拡張が考えられます。
- 高度なトークン属性: トークンの発行時に、所有権の制限、譲渡条件、投票権などの属性を付与することで、より多様な金融商品の表現が可能になります。例えば、株式や債券などの証券化されたアセットをモザイクとして表現し、ブロックチェーン上で管理することができます。
- トークン間の相互運用性: 異なるモザイク間でのアトミックな交換を可能にする機能です。これにより、分散型取引所(DEX)における流動性の向上や、異なるブロックチェーン間でのアセットの移動が容易になります。
- NFT(Non-Fungible Token)のサポート強化: モザイクをNFTとして利用するための機能を強化することで、デジタルアート、ゲームアイテム、知的財産などのユニークなアセットの管理をより効率的に行うことができます。
2. スマートコントラクト機能の進化
ネムは、当初からスマートコントラクト機能を搭載していましたが、その表現力や実行効率には改善の余地がありました。今後の進化により、より複雑なビジネスロジックを実装し、様々なアプリケーションを開発することが可能になると期待されます。具体的には、以下の機能進化が考えられます。
- 新しいスマートコントラクト言語の導入: 現在のスマートコントラクト言語に加えて、より表現力豊かで、開発しやすい新しい言語を導入することで、開発者の参入障壁を下げ、より高度なアプリケーションの開発を促進します。
- 仮想マシンの最適化: スマートコントラクトの実行効率を向上させるために、仮想マシンを最適化します。これにより、ガス代の削減や、処理速度の向上を実現し、より実用的なアプリケーションの開発を可能にします。
- 形式検証の導入: スマートコントラクトのコードにバグがないことを数学的に証明する形式検証の技術を導入することで、セキュリティリスクを低減し、信頼性の高いアプリケーションの開発を支援します。
3. サイドチェーンとブリッジ技術の活用
ネムのメインチェーンのスケーラビリティ問題を解決し、より多様なアプリケーションに対応するために、サイドチェーンとブリッジ技術の活用が期待されます。サイドチェーンは、メインチェーンから独立したブロックチェーンであり、特定の用途に特化した機能を実装することができます。ブリッジ技術は、メインチェーンとサイドチェーン間でアセットやデータを安全に移動させるための技術です。具体的には、以下の活用方法が考えられます。
- プライベートサイドチェーン: 企業や団体が、機密性の高いデータを安全に管理するためのプライベートサイドチェーンを構築することができます。
- スケーラビリティ向上サイドチェーン: メインチェーンのトランザクション処理能力を向上させるためのサイドチェーンを構築することができます。
- 相互運用性ブリッジ: 他のブロックチェーンとの相互運用性を実現するためのブリッジを構築することができます。これにより、異なるブロックチェーン間でのアセットの移動や、データの共有が可能になります。
4. 機密トランザクション技術の導入
ブロックチェーンの透明性は、その信頼性を高める重要な要素ですが、一方で、プライバシー保護の観点からは課題となることもあります。機密トランザクション技術を導入することで、トランザクションの内容を隠蔽し、プライバシーを保護することができます。具体的には、以下の技術が考えられます。
- リング署名: トランザクションの送信者を特定することを困難にする技術です。
- zk-SNARKs: トランザクションの内容を検証しつつ、その詳細を隠蔽する技術です。
- Confidential Transactions: トランザクションの金額を隠蔽する技術です。
5. データストレージ機能の強化
ブロックチェーンは、データの改ざんを防ぐための分散型台帳技術ですが、大量のデータを保存するにはコストがかかります。データストレージ機能を強化することで、より多くのデータを効率的に保存し、様々なアプリケーションに対応することが可能になります。具体的には、以下の機能強化が考えられます。
- IPFS(InterPlanetary File System)との連携: IPFSは、分散型のファイルストレージシステムであり、ブロックチェーンと連携することで、大量のデータを効率的に保存することができます。
- オフチェーンストレージ: ブロックチェーン上に保存する必要のないデータを、オフチェーンのストレージに保存することで、ブロックチェーンの容量を節約することができます。
- データ圧縮技術の導入: データを圧縮することで、ブロックチェーンの容量を節約することができます。
6. デジタルアイデンティティ(DID)機能の統合
デジタルアイデンティティ(DID)は、個人や組織を識別するためのデジタルなIDであり、ブロックチェーン技術と組み合わせることで、安全で信頼性の高いアイデンティティ管理システムを構築することができます。ネムにDID機能を統合することで、以下のメリットが期待されます。
- 自己主権型アイデンティティ: 個人が自身のアイデンティティ情報を管理し、コントロールすることができます。
- プライバシー保護: 個人情報の漏洩リスクを低減することができます。
- 信頼性の向上: アイデンティティ情報の改ざんを防ぐことができます。
7. 機械学習(ML)との連携
機械学習(ML)は、データからパターンを学習し、予測や判断を行うための技術です。ネムとMLを連携させることで、以下の応用が考えられます。
- 不正検知: ブロックチェーン上のトランザクションを分析し、不正なトランザクションを検知することができます。
- リスク評価: 金融商品のリスクを評価することができます。
- 予測分析: 市場の動向を予測することができます。
まとめ
ネム(XEM)は、モザイク機能の拡張、スマートコントラクト機能の進化、サイドチェーンとブリッジ技術の活用、機密トランザクション技術の導入、データストレージ機能の強化、デジタルアイデンティティ(DID)機能の統合、機械学習(ML)との連携など、様々な新機能の導入により、その可能性をさらに広げることが期待されます。これらの新機能は、ネムを単なる分散型台帳技術から、より多様なアプリケーションを構築するためのプラットフォームへと進化させ、ブロックチェーン技術の普及に貢献するものと考えられます。今後のネムの発展に注目し、その技術が社会にもたらす影響を注視していくことが重要です。